After nudge from Macron, Trump and other G7 leaders agree on coronavirus coordination

(CNN) — Leaders of the world’s advanced economies agreed Monday to coordinate their response to a growing coronavirus pandemic even as fractures emerge between Europe and the United States over travel restrictions and efforts to develop a vaccine. Dow drops to three-year low as stocks tumble again

(CNN) — US stocks are sharply lower on Monday, with the Dow falling to its lowest level in nearly three years. Worries mounted that central banks’ emergency measures over the weekend meant the economy is in much worse shape than previously believed. Tenn. brothers clear stores of sanitizer products for resale

Two Tennessee brothers cleared stores shelves in two states of thousands of bottles of hand sanitizer and packs of antibacterial wipes in an elaborate plan to resell them for profit during the U.S. coronavirus outbreak.
